Delicious. Medium gold color. Nose is lemon curd, salinity, minerality. Mouthful is tart lemon with a bit of granny apple. Plenty of minerality and acidic cut. A medium plus finish. A classy structured white burgundy. At its peak? Probably in a great spot today and the next 2-3 years before the fruit lessens? Very enjoyable today though so I wouldn’t hesitate to drink it now.
